Track and Trace

In a world full of counterfeiting, which costs businesses billions of dollars each year and puts health of consumers at risk with defective food, medicine and other products, it is essential to ensure security and transparency throughout the supply chain. Digital authentication, usually reserved for high-value goods and brands, can ensure the safety of brands at throughout the process. Pragmatic's extremely low-cost flexible and flexible integrated systems allow you to integrate security measures along the supply chain.

A lack of visibility into the supply chain causes a lack of visibility and slow response. Small shipping mistakes can frustrate customers and force businesses to find an expensive and time-consuming solution. Businesses can identify problems quickly and fix them promptly to avoid costly disruptions.

The term "track-and-trace" is used to describe a system of interlinked, software that is able to determine a shipment's past or present position, an asset's present location, or even a temperature trail. This information is then analysed to help ensure quality, safety and compliance with laws and regulations. This technology also improves efficiency in logistics by reducing inventory that is not needed and identifying bottlenecks that could be.

Currently, the majority of companies use track and 프라그마틱 슬롯 무료 trace to manage internal processes. It is becoming more popular for customers to use it. It is because many consumers expect a reliable, fast delivery service. In addition the tracking and tracing process can provide better customer service and increased sales.

For instance, utilities have used track and trace for managing the fleet of power tools to reduce the risk of injuries to workers. The smart tools in these systems can tell when they're being misused and shut off themselves to avoid injury. They also monitor and report the force required to tighten screws.

In other cases, track-and-trace can be used to verify the skills of a worker for the task. When a utility worker is installing pipes, for instance, they must be certified. A Track and Trace system can scan an ID badge and then compare it with the utility's Operator Qualification database to make sure the right people are performing the job correctly at the right times.

Anticounterfeiting

Counterfeiting has become a significant problem for businesses, consumers and governments across the world. Its complexity and scale has grown with globalization because counterfeiters can operate in multiple countries with different laws and regulations, as well as different languages and time zones. It is difficult to track and trace their activities. Counterfeiting could hinder economic growth, damage brand reputation and could put a risk to human health.

The global anticounterfeiting, authentication and verifiability technologies market is expected to expand at an annual rate of 11.8% between 2018 and 프라그마틱 슬롯 추천 2023. This is due to the increasing demand for products with enhanced security features. This technology can also be used to monitor supply chains and protect intellectual property rights. It also guards against online squatting and unfair competition. The fight against counterfeiting requires the collaboration of stakeholders around the globe.

Counterfeiters can market their fake products by mimicking authentic items using an inexpensive production process. They are able to use different methods and tools, 프라그마틱 카지노 including holograms, QR codes, RFID tags, and holograms, to make their items appear genuine. They also have websites and social media accounts to market their products. Anticounterfeiting technologies are important for both consumer and business security.

Some fake products can be dangerous to the health of consumers while other counterfeit products cause financial losses for businesses. The damage caused by counterfeiting could include recalls of products, loss of sales and fraudulent warranty claims and costs for overproduction. Companies that are impacted by counterfeiting could find it difficult to gain trust and loyalty from customers. The quality of counterfeit products is also low and can harm the image and reputation of the business.

A new anticounterfeiting technique can help businesses defend their products from counterfeiters by printing security features 3D. University of Maryland chemical and biomolecular engineering Ph.D. student Po-Yen Chen worked with colleagues from Anhui University of Technology and Qian Xie in the development of this new method of safeguarding goods from counterfeits. The team's research uses an AI-powered AI software as well as an 2D material label to verify the authenticity.

Authentication

Authentication is a vital aspect of security that checks the identity and credentials of an individual. It is not the same as authorization, which decides which files or tasks the user is able to access. Authentication compares credentials with existing identities to confirm access. It is a necessary part of any security system, but it can be hacked by sophisticated hackers. Using the best authentication techniques can make it difficult for fraudsters and thieves to exploit you.

There are a variety of authentication, from biometrics, password-based, to biometrics and voice recognition. The most popular type of authentication is password-based. It requires the user to enter a password that is similar to the one they have stored. The system will reject passwords that do not match. Hackers are able to quickly guess weak passwords, so it's important to use strong passwords that are at least 10 characters long. Biometrics is an advanced method of authentication. It can include fingerprint scanning or retinal pattern scanning and facial recognition. These kinds of methods are extremely difficult for attackers to duplicate or fake, so they're considered the most secure form of authentication.

Security

A crucial feature of any digital object is that it must be protected from malicious manipulation or accidental corruption. This can be achieved through the combination of authenticity and non-repudiation. Authenticity confirms the identity of an object (by internal metadata) and non-repudiation proves that the object was not altered after it was sent.

While traditional methods for establishing authenticity of an object require identifying deceit or malice and sabotage, checking for integrity can be more efficient and less intrusive. The test for integrity is to compare an artifact against some precisely identified and rigorously vetted initial version or authentic copy. This method has its limits however, particularly in an environment where the integrity of an object may be compromised by a range of circumstances that are not related to malice or fraud.
